WebNon-flowering plants. Non-flowering plants are divided into two main groups – those that reproduce with dust-like particles called spores and those that use seeds to reproduce. PLANT REPRODUCTION. WebThe parts of a flower include: Pollen, a dust-like substance that is used to fertilise other flowers. Petals, which are brightly coloured to attract insects. The stamen, the male part of the flower. The stigma, the female part of the flower. The pistil, the lower part of the female part of the flower. The ovule, the part of the flower that will ...
